Zum Hauptinhalt springen

So überprüfen Sie die Übereinstimmung zweier Zellen in Excel und führen bestimmte Aktionen aus

Excel ist ein leistungsfähiges Datenwerkzeug, mit dem Sie Routineaufgaben automatisieren und große Mengen an Informationen verarbeiten können. Eine dieser Aufgaben besteht darin, die Übereinstimmung von Werten in zwei Zellen zu überprüfen und je nach Ergebnis bestimmte Aktionen auszuführen.

In Excel können Sie die IF-Funktion mit einer Bedingung überprüfen, die zwei Zellen verknüpft und die erforderlichen Aktionen definiert, um zu überprüfen, ob Werte übereinstimmen. Wenn beispielsweise die Werte in zwei Zellen gleich sind, müssen Sie eine Aktion ausführen, und wenn die Werte nicht übereinstimmen, müssen Sie eine andere Aktion ausführen.

Dazu können Sie die folgende Formel verwenden: =IF(A1=B1,"Aktion 1", "Aktion 2"). Hier sind A1 und B1 die Adressen der Zellen, die verglichen werden sollen, "Aktion 1" ist die Aktion, die ausgeführt werden soll, wenn die Werte übereinstimmen, und "Aktion 2" ist die Aktion, die ausgeführt werden soll, wenn die Werte nicht übereinstimmen.

Diese Formel kann beispielsweise nützlich sein, wenn Sie Daten in einer Tabelle anhand verschiedener Kriterien vergleichen. Es ermöglicht Ihnen, den Prozess der Überprüfung auf übereinstimmende Werte zu automatisieren und die Arbeit mit Daten zu vereinfachen.

Methoden zum Überprüfen der Übereinstimmung zweier Zellen in Excel und zum Ausführen von Aktionen

Microsoft Excel bietet verschiedene Möglichkeiten, die Übereinstimmung zweier Zellen zu überprüfen und bestimmte Aktionen basierend auf den Ergebnissen dieser Überprüfung durchzuführen. Im Folgenden werden einige Optionen beschrieben, die bei der Arbeit mit Daten in Excel nützlich sein können.

  1. Verwenden der IF-Funktion:
    • Mit der IF-Funktion können Sie die Werte zweier Zellen vergleichen und bestimmte Aktionen basierend auf dem Vergleichsergebnis ausführen. Die Syntax der IF-Funktion lautet wie folgt: =IF(Bedingung, Wert, Wert, Wert, Wert, Wert) . Um beispielsweise zu überprüfen, ob die Werte in den Zellen A1 und B1 übereinstimmen, können Sie eine Formel verwenden: =IF(A1=B1, "Werte stimmen überein", "Werte stimmen nicht überein") . Das Ergebnis dieser Formel ist die Zeile "Werte stimmen überein", wenn die Werte der Zellen A1 und B1 übereinstimmen und andernfalls die Zeile "Werte stimmen nicht überein" lautet.
  2. Bedingte Formatierung verwenden:
    • Mit der bedingten Formatierung können Sie das Aussehen von Zellen basierend auf den angegebenen Bedingungen ändern. Sie können die bedingte Formatierung verwenden, um übereinstimmende oder unterschiedliche Werte in zwei Zellen hervorzuheben. Sie können beispielsweise bedingte Formatierung anwenden, um den Zellenhintergrund grün zu machen, wenn die Werte in den beiden Zellen übereinstimmen, und rot, wenn sich die Werte unterscheiden.
  3. Verwenden von Makros:
    • Makros sind aufgezeichnete Befehlsserien, die ausgeführt werden können, um bestimmte Aktionen automatisch in Excel auszuführen. Sie können ein Makro erstellen, das die Werte in zwei Zellen vergleicht und basierend auf den Vergleichsergebnissen bestimmte Aktionen ausführt. Sie können beispielsweise ein Makro erstellen, das übereinstimmende Werte fett formatiert hervorhebt oder die Werte in eine andere Zelle kopiert, wenn sie nicht übereinstimmen.
  4. Verwenden von Suchformeln:
    • Mit Suchformeln können Sie nach übereinstimmenden Werten in einem Zellbereich suchen und bestimmte Aktionen basierend auf den Suchergebnissen ausführen. Sie können beispielsweise die Formel VLOOKUP oder INDEX/MATCH verwenden, um nach übereinstimmenden Werten in zwei verschiedenen Zellbereichen zu suchen und bestimmte Aktionen auszuführen, z. B. das Kopieren eines Werts oder das Markieren einer Zelle.

Die Auswahl der am besten geeigneten Methode hängt von der jeweiligen Situation und den Anforderungen für die Datenanalyse in Excel ab. Diese Methoden können kombiniert werden, um die gewünschten Ergebnisse zu erzielen.

Verwenden der IF-Funktion

Sie können die IF-Funktion verwenden, um die Übereinstimmung zweier Zellen in Excel zu überprüfen und bestimmte Aktionen auszuführen. Mit der IF-Funktion können Sie eine Bedingung festlegen und eine Aktion ausführen, wenn die Bedingung erfüllt ist, und eine andere Aktion ausführen, wenn die Bedingung nicht erfüllt ist.

Im einfachsten Fall akzeptiert die IF-Funktion drei Argumente: eine Bedingung, eine Aktion bei Wahr und eine Aktion bei Falsch. Sie können den Vergleichsoperator (=) in einer Funktionsbedingung verwenden, um zu überprüfen, ob zwei Zellen übereinstimmen.

Um beispielsweise zu überprüfen, ob der Inhalt von Zelle A1 und Zelle B1 übereinstimmt, können Sie die folgende Formel verwenden:

Zelle A1Zelle B1Ergebnis
123123Zufall
456789Kein Zufall

Die Formel lautet wie folgt:

=IF(A1=B1, "Übereinstimmung", "Keine Übereinstimmung")

In diesem Beispiel wird, wenn der Inhalt von Zelle A1 dem Inhalt von Zelle B1 entspricht, der Text "Übereinstimmung" angezeigt, andernfalls wird der Text "Keine Übereinstimmung" angezeigt.

Mit der IF-Funktion können Sie daher überprüfen, ob zwei Zellen in Excel übereinstimmen und abhängig vom Ergebnis der Überprüfung bestimmte Aktionen ausführen.

Bedingte Formatierung anwenden

Excel verfügt über ein leistungsfähiges Werkzeug namens bedingte Formatierung, mit dem Sie basierend auf festgelegten Bedingungen automatisch eine bestimmte Formatierung auf Zellen anwenden können. Dies ist sehr nützlich, wenn Sie bestimmte Daten auswählen oder bestimmte Aktionen ausführen müssen, wenn die Werte in zwei Zellen übereinstimmen.

Um bedingte Formatierung auf zwei Zellen anzuwenden, führen Sie die folgenden Schritte aus:

  1. Wählen Sie die Zelle aus, in der Sie prüfen möchten, ob Werte übereinstimmen.
  2. Klicken Sie auf der Symbolleiste auf die Registerkarte Bedingte Formatierung.
  3. Wählen Sie die Option Zellenhelligkeitsregeln aus und wählen Sie Gleich. ".
  4. Geben Sie einen Verweis auf die zweite Zelle ein, um die Werte zu vergleichen.
  5. Wählen Sie die gewünschte Formatierung für Zellen aus, in denen die Werte übereinstimmen.
  6. Klicken Sie auf OK, um die bedingte Formatierung anzuwenden.

Nachdem Sie die bedingte Formatierung angewendet haben, überprüft Excel automatisch die Werte in den beiden Zellen und wendet die angegebene Formatierung auf die Zelle an, wenn die Werte übereinstimmen. Dies kann nützlich sein, wenn Sie übereinstimmende Daten schnell auswählen oder bestimmte Aktionen ausführen müssen, wenn Werte übereinstimmen.

Wenn beispielsweise eine Zelle den Namen einer Person und eine andere Zelle das Alter einer Person enthält, können Sie mithilfe der bedingten Formatierung die Zeilen markieren, in denen das Alter mit dem angegebenen Wert übereinstimmt. Auf diese Weise können Sie Personen eines bestimmten Alters schnell finden und die erforderlichen Schritte mit diesen Daten ausführen.

Die Verwendung der bedingten Formatierung in Excel erleichtert die Analyse von Daten und die Ausführung verschiedener Aufgaben erheblich. Es ermöglicht Ihnen, bestimmte Daten basierend auf bestimmten Bedingungen schnell zuzuordnen und zu verarbeiten, was die Arbeit mit Tabellen effizienter macht und bessere Entscheidungen erleichtert.

Erstellen eines Makros für die automatische Überprüfung

In Excel können Sie ein Makro erstellen, das die Werte zweier Zellen automatisch vergleicht und abhängig vom Ergebnis des Vergleichs bestimmte Aktionen ausführt.

Um ein Makro in Excel zu erstellen, müssen Sie den Visual Basic-Editor öffnen. Dazu können Sie die Tastenkombination Alt + F11 verwenden. Wählen Sie im Editor das Modul aus, in das das Makro geschrieben werden soll, oder erstellen Sie ein neues Modul.

Nachdem Sie den Visual Basic-Editor geöffnet haben, können Sie Code für das Makro schreiben. Es folgt ein Beispielcode, der die Werte in zwei Zellen vergleicht und eine Meldung anzeigt, wenn sie übereinstimmen:

Sub-Überprüfungübereinstimmungen() Dim-Wert1 As String Dim-Wert2 As String-Wert1 = Range("A1").Value Wert2 = Range("B1").Value If Wert1 = Wert2 Then MsgBox "Die Zellen A1 und B1 enthalten denselben Wert" Else MsgBox "Die Zellen A1 und B1 enthalten unterschiedliche Werte" End If End Sub

In diesem Codebeispiel werden die Werte aus den Zellen A1 und B1 mit dem Operator = verglichen. Wenn die Werte übereinstimmen, gibt das Makro eine Meldung aus, dass die Zellen dieselben Werte enthalten. Wenn sich die Werte unterscheiden, gibt das Makro eine Meldung aus, dass die Zellen unterschiedliche Werte enthalten.

Nachdem Sie den Makrocode geschrieben haben, können Sie ihn ausführen, indem Sie auf die Schaltfläche Ausführen klicken oder F5 drücken. Wenn die Werte in den Zellen übereinstimmen, wird eine Übereinstimmungsmeldung angezeigt. Wenn sich die Werte unterscheiden, wird eine Meldung über den Unterschied angezeigt.

Durch das Erstellen eines Makros in Excel können Sie daher die Überprüfung der Übereinstimmung von Werten in zwei Zellen automatisieren und bestimmte Aktionen basierend auf dieser Überprüfung ausführen.

Verwenden der VLOOKUP-Formel

Bevor Sie die Formel VLOOKUP anwenden können, müssen Sie Bedingungen erstellen, unter denen eine bestimmte Aktion ausgeführt wird. Zum Beispiel können wir Werte aus Spalte A mit Werten aus Spalte B vergleichen und eine Aktion ausführen, wenn die Werte übereinstimmen.

Folgen Sie der folgenden Struktur, um die VLOOKUP-Formel in Excel zu verwenden:

=VLOOKUP(искомое_значение, диапазон, номер_столбца, [точное_совпадение])

In dieser Formel:

  • sucht_wert: zu findender Wert
  • Temperaturbereich: Der Zellenbereich, in dem Sie suchen möchten. Dieser Bereich muss zwei Spalten enthalten: die Spalte mit den gesuchten Werten und die Spalte, aus der der Wert zurückgegeben werden soll
  • spaltennummer: die Nummer der Spalte, aus der der Wert zurückgegeben werden soll. Es ist normalerweise 2, da es die zweite Spalte im Bereich ist
  • exaktes Abgleichen (optional): TRUE oder FALSE, der angibt, ob nach einer genauen Übereinstimmung gesucht werden soll. Wenn kein Parameter angegeben wird, ist der Standardwert TRUE, was bedeutet, dass nach einer genauen Übereinstimmung gesucht wird

Basierend auf dem Ergebnis der VLOOKUP-Formel, die den entsprechenden Wert aus Spalte B basierend auf übereinstimmenden Werten aus Spalte A zurückgibt, können Sie Ihrer Excel-Tabelle Logik hinzufügen und Aktionen basierend auf den Bedingungen automatisieren.

Daher können Sie mithilfe der Formel "VLOOKUP" effektiv die Übereinstimmungen zweier Zellen überprüfen und die gewünschten Aktionen basierend auf den Validierungsergebnissen ausführen.

Erstellen einer eigenen Funktion in VBA

Mit VBA (Visual Basic for Applications) können Sie benutzerdefinierte Funktionen in Excel erstellen, mit denen Sie Aufgaben automatisieren und die Arbeit mit Daten vereinfachen können. Das Erstellen einer eigenen Funktion in VBA kann nützlich sein, wenn Sie komplexe Berechnungen oder Manipulationen von Daten auf nicht standardmäßige Weise durchführen müssen.

Sie müssen einige Schritte ausführen, um eine eigene Funktion in Excel in VBA zu erstellen:

  1. Öffnen Sie den Visual Basic-Editor mit einem Klick Alt+F11. Wählen Sie im geöffneten Fenster das gewünschte Projekt aus (z. B. "Tabelle1") und wählen Sie im Menü Einfügen -> Modul aus.
  2. Schreiben Sie im erstellten Modul den Funktionscode. Diese Funktion muss mit einem Schlüsselwort deklariert werden Function. Zum Beispiel:

Function MyFunction(arg1 As String, arg2 As Integer) As String' Код функции' . MyFunction = "Результат"End Function

Jetzt ist Ihre eigene Funktion über Excel-Zellen verfügbar. Um eine Funktion in einer Zelle zu verwenden, muss sie bei Bedarf mit einem Namen mit Argumenten aufgerufen werden. Zum Beispiel, um eine Funktion aufzurufen MyFunction mit den Argumenten "Hallo" und "5" muss in die Zelle eingegeben werden:

Nach dem Drücken Enter das Ergebnis der Funktion wird in der Zelle angezeigt.

Beachten Sie, dass Sie beim Erstellen eigener Funktionen alle Funktionen von VBA nutzen können, einschließlich der integrierten Excel-Funktionen, Schleifen, bedingten Anweisungen und anderer Sprachkonstrukte. Sie können auch Funktionen mit einer beliebigen Anzahl von Argumenten und verschiedenen Rückgabetypen erstellen.

Das Erstellen einer benutzerdefinierten Funktion in VBA kann Ihre Arbeit mit Daten in Excel erheblich verbessern, Aufgaben automatisieren und Zeit sparen. Versuchen Sie, diese Gelegenheit zu nutzen und spüren Sie die Vorteile, die sie Ihnen in Ihrem Projekt oder Ihrer Arbeit bringen kann!